Yeah, apparently the local hunters knew they existed for some time. IIRC the same thing apparently happened WRT the coelacanth - after it was rediscovered off the coast of Africa, someone else discovered that it had been available in fish markets on the eastern side of the Indian Ocean.
Locals call the rodent kha-nyou. Scientists haven't yet a bagged a breathing one, only the bodies of those recently caught by hunters or for sale at meat markets, where researchers with the New York-based conservation society first spotted the creature.
